Renault Symbol:
The Renault Symbol, Clio or Thalia in some markets, is a subcompact sedan produced by the French automobile manufacturer Renault. It was introduced in late 1999, under the Clio Symbol name, as the derivative version of the second generation Renault Clio, and unlike the hatchback it was marketed only in those countries where saloons were traditionally preferred over hatchbacks, while it was not sold in Western Europe. Specifications:
| General: |
| Brand: | Renault |
| Model: | Symbol |
| Generation: | I (facelift 2002) |
| Modification (Engine): | 1.6 i 16V (107 Hp) |
| Start of production: | 2002 |
| End of production: | 2008 |
| Powertrain Architecture: | Internal Combustion engine |
| Body type: | Sedan |
| Seats: | 5 |
| Doors: | 4 |
| Engine: |
| Power: | 107 Hp @ 5750 rpm. |
| Power per litre: | 67 Hp/l |
| Torque: | 148 Nm @ 3750 rpm. |
| Engine Model/Code: | K4M 740 |
| Engine displacement: | 1598 |
| Number of cylinders: | 4 |
| Engine configuration: | Inline |
| Number of valves per cylinder: | 4 |
| Fuel injection system: | Multi-port manifold injection |
| Engine aspiration: | Naturally aspirated engine |
| Valvetrain: | DOHC |
| Engine oil capacity: | 4.85 l |
| Coolant: | 5.7 l |
| Engine layout: | Front, Transverse |
| Cylinder Bore: | 79.5 mm mm |
| Piston Stroke: | 80.5 mm mm |
| Compression ratio: | 10:1 |
| Performance: |
| Fuel Type: | Petrol (Gasoline) |
| Fuel consumption (economy) - urban: | 9.9 l/100 km |
| Fuel consumption (economy) - extra urban: | 5.6 l/100 km |
| Acceleration 0 - 100 km/h: | 9.9 sec |
| Acceleration 0 - 62 mph: | 9.9 sec |
| Maximum speed: | 191 km/h |
| Weight-to-power ratio: | 9 kg/Hp, 111.5 Hp/tonne |
| Weight-to-torque ratio: | 6.5 kg/Nm, 154.2 Nm/tonne |
| Acceleration 0 - 60 mph: | 9.4 sec |
| Space: |
| Kerb Weight: | 960 |
| Max. weight: | 1485 |
| Max load: | 525 |
| Trunk (boot) space - minimum: | 510 l |
| Fuel tank capacity: | 50 l |
| Size: |
| Length: | 4171 mm mm |
| Width: | 1639 mm mm |
| Height: | 1437 mm mm |
| Wheelbase: | 2472 mm mm |
| Front track: | 1406 mm |
| Rear (Back) track: | 1386 mm |
